在使用TPWallet进行数字资产转账时,用户可能会不小心将资产发送到了合约地址。合约地址通常是智能合约的部署地址,不同于普通用户的钱包地址。此类错误可能会导致用户无法直接访问他们的资金,给用户带来不小的困扰。但是,可以采取一些措施尝试解决这一问题。本文将详细探讨这一过程的各个方面。

什么是TPWallet?

TPWallet是一种去中心化的数字资产钱包,支持多种区块链资产的存储、管理和交易。TPWallet具有用户友好的界面和多样化的功能选项,如DApp浏览、资产管理、跨链转账等。用户可以通过TPWallet方便地进行各类数字资产的操作,然而,随着使用的普及,用户也面临着一些潜在的风险和错误操作的情况,例如将资产转账转到了合约地址上。

合约地址的定义与特性

TPWallet转账转到了合约地址怎么办?

合约地址是指部署智能合约后所生成的一个地址,它与普通的用户钱包地址不同。合约地址被设计用来执行自动化的算法和规则,用户不能直接从合约地址中提取资金。合约内存储的资产通常只能通过合约的功能进行管理和操作。因此,一旦资产转入合约地址,用户将很难找回这些资金。

转账到合约地址后的处理步骤

如果您已经不小心将资金转到了合约地址,以下是一些可以尝试的步骤:

1. **确认转账信息**:首先,请确认您确实将资产转账到了合约地址。可以通过区块链浏览器查询交易记录,确保资产已经发送到错误的地址。

2. **尝试联系合约开发者**:如果您知道这个合约的开发者,可以尝试联系他们。说明您的情况,有时候开发者可以提供帮助,尤其是如果合约有恢复功能。

3. **使用智能合约功能**:如果合约自身提供了解析和交互的功能,可以尝试利用这些功能找回资产。有些合约可能会允许运营者或特定用户解除锁定资产的权限。

4. **寻求专业帮助**:如果以上步骤都无效,可以向区块链领域的专业人士或支持社区寻求帮助。可能会有技术专家能够帮助您分析和解决问题。

常见问题解答

TPWallet转账转到了合约地址怎么办?

我可以通过Etherscan等区块链浏览器查看转账状态吗?

是的,您可以利用Etherscan等区块链浏览器来查看有关您转账的详细信息。只需将您的交易哈希输入到区块链浏览器中,即可查看数据,包括确认状态、转账的具体时间和金额、转出地址和转入地址等信息。这些信息将帮助您确认转账是否确实发生在合约地址上。

如果合约地址不上线,也无法再接触到资产,能否恢复我的资产?

如果合约地址关闭或部署者不再维护该合约,资产的恢复将变得非常复杂,甚至几乎不可能。这是因为大多数合约没有提供直接的资产恢复功能。如果没有足够的技术知识或能力来与合约进行交互,您可能需要依赖于合约的设计和运营者的回应。在这种情况下,用户的资产可能永远无法找回,因此在转账时一定要谨慎核对地址。

如何避免将数字资产转账到合约地址?

为了避免将数字资产转账到合约地址,用户应当采取包括但不限于以下的预防措施:首先,在转账前,确认接受地址的类型。通常,合约和钱包之间的地址在外观上可能类似,但它们的功能却大相径庭。其次,可以通过进行小额测试转账来确认无误,这是在大额交易前一种很有效的安全措施。此外,了解您使用的各种合约功能及其潜在的风险也是相当重要的。

转账到合约地址的风险有哪些?

转账到合约地址的风险主要体现在无法找回资金。一旦资产转入合约地址,用户可能失去对这些资产的完全控制权。合约的设计和执行方式各不相同,某些合约不允许用户直接提取资金。此外,有些合约可能存在漏洞或已被攻击,导致资产损失。因此,用户在进行数字资产交易时需提高警惕,确保信息的准确无误。

综上所述,在使用TPWallet进行资产转账时,务必在操作之前认真核对地址,确保资金安全。如果不慎转账至合约地址,虽然恢复资金的可能性极小,但仍可以尝试通过上述步骤寻求帮助。了解合约的基本概念和相关知识,将有助于避免此类错误的发生。